How to make it

  • Saute bell pepper and onions in butter in a stockpot.
  • Add the shrimp.
  • SAute until the shrimp turn pink.
  • Add the tomatoes with green chiles, soup and rice and mix well.
  • Spoon into a baking dish.
  • Bake at 350 degrees for 30 minutes.
